Broadmeadow is a beautiful country house with nice surrounding walks, great breakfast and a friendly staff. Airport parking package adds another great facility and proximity to Dublin city, many of the historical sites and Dublin Airport add to the convenience. A great place to stay. More

We had a friendly Irish welcome and were allocated a large family room for our party of 2 adults and 1 child in this country house. It had comfortable beds, local channel tv, tea/coffee making facilities, and a fair sized en suite bathroom.
